Large dataset of emission induced "shiptrack" clouds, detected using deep-learning, from satellite based remote sensing data with global coverage, from 2002 to 2021 for the Atmospheric Composition and Radiative forcing changes due to UN International Ship Emissions regulations (ACRUISE) project. Shiptracks were inferred from every daylight granule captured by the MODerate Imaging Spectroradiometer (MODIS) instrument, onboard the NOAA-AQUA satellite from 2002-2021 inclusive and stored in a compressed netcdf file. In addition, polygons corresponding to contours of level 0.5 and 0.8 from the inference images are provided as a light-weight alternative. These are stored in annual geopackages in the geographic projection. The model is a standard neural-network based segmentation model with a UNet architecture, a resnet-152 backbone and sigmoid activation on the final layer that was pre-trained on the 2012 ImageNet Large Scale Visual Recognition Challenge 2012 (ILSVRC2012) ImageNet dataset. This model was trained to segment clouds formed by ship exhausts, known as shiptracks, from MODIS level 1b, day microphysics composite granules enhanced through histogram stretching. The purpose of these data is to measure the effect that shipping fuel regulation has on climate change and to reduce the uncertainty in the relationship between aerosols and cloud formation and properties. This allows the determination of where tracks are more likely to form and the sensitivity of clouds to such perturbations.The data indicate a sharp reduction in tracks due to the more stringent ship emission regulations since 2020. A small minority of granules (<0.5%) are missing due to a combination of missing or corrupt files and/or unexpected computational processing failures. These remained unresolved as they were judged insignificant compared to model uncertainties and and of negligible additional benefit to warrant the overheads to resolve each missing granule.
